My hero is Stephen Robert Irwin, though most of you probably know him simply as Steve Irwin The Crocodile Hunter. Steve was born February 22nd 1962 in Essendon, a suburb of Melbourne, Victoria. Shortly after being born Steve moved to Queensland with his parents. His parents started a small Queensland Reptile and Fauna Park where Steve was constantly surrounded by crocodiles and other reptiles. He grew an instant passion for all animals, especially reptiles. On his sixth birthday he received a 12 foot python, and he handled his first crocodile at the age of nine.

Steve's show "The Crocodile Hunter" first hit the screens in 1996 where it spread like wild fire to North America. He made several movies and appearances on TV by 1999 making him known world wide. Steve Irwin was not out for fame though, he was an educator.

Steve Irwin felt that it was his personal mission to educate the world about wild life conservation. He started the show and made the movies so that he might teach others about the animals he loved so much. He taught so many people about the importance of saving and protecting wild animals, even the scaley ones. Steve Irwin has touched all of our lives whether you realize it or not. Even for those who didn't learn the lessons he had to teach, he probably captured you with his exuberant and enthusiastic personality, broad Australian accent, signature khaki shorts, and catchphrase "Crikey!"

On September 4, 2006 Steve died a tragic and ironic death. The man who wrestled deadly behemoths for a living was not killed by the crocodiles he loved so much. Instead he was pierced through the heart by the barb of a stingray. This event shocked the world. People everywhere felt the loss of the beloved animal enthusiast. We will miss you Steve.
